Leon Center Rooms 2*
Main amenities
-
Wi-Fi
-
24-hour services
-
Air conditioning
-
No pets allowed
Location
Offering a luggage room, the 2-star Leon Center Rooms hotel lies in the Old Town district, merely 1.2 km from Auditorium Ciudad de Leon and nearly 5 minutes' walk from the Basilica of San Isidoro. Boasting a location a stone's throw from the gothic-era Santa Maria de Leon Cathedral, the guest house offers 17 rooms and a tapas bar onsite.
This Leon hotel is ideally located about metres from Parque del Cid and 350 m from the Guzmanes' Palace. The Center Rooms Leon is located in the historic city centre. The Guzmán El Bueno Square is approximately a 15-minute walk away, and Leon train station is situated within a few blocks of the accommodation. Independencia bus stop is only 600 m from the hotel.
Some of the air-conditioned rooms have a kitchen and a dining area, and such facilities as free Wi-Fi and a flat-screen TV with satellite channels, along with tea and coffee making equipment. They are outfitted with charming decor. Guests can also enjoy views of the sea. A kitchen with a fridge, an oven, and a cooktop are available in a holiday home.
The Center Rooms serves continental breakfast in the morning. Healthy cuisine is offered at Restaurante Ezequiel, situated in close proximity to the property.
Important information
- Children and extra beds
- Maximum capacity of extra beds in a room is 1.